DICKEY COUNTY, N.D. — Sen. Heidi Heitkamp in an interview Thursday lashed President Trump on border security, charging that the administration has failed to produce an adequate blueprint for halting illegal crossings from Mexico.
The Democrat, fighting an uphill re-election battle in this pro-Trump Republican bastion, chided the president on his signature issue, saying she has yet to see a cogent plan for fixing interior enforcement or building a wall along the southern border that will work. Heitkamp reserved some of that fire for fellow Democrats, pointedly disagreeing with liberals who dismiss concerns about illegal immigration and want Immigration and Customs Enforcement, or ICE, abolished.
